首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从不同服务器上的另一个oracle实例连接到oracle实例

从不同服务器上的另一个Oracle实例连接到Oracle实例,可以通过以下步骤进行:

  1. 配置网络连接:确保两个服务器之间可以相互访问。可以使用私有网络或者公共网络进行连接。如果使用公共网络,需要确保服务器上的防火墙允许Oracle数据库的通信端口。
  2. 安装Oracle客户端:在另一个服务器上安装Oracle客户端软件,以便能够连接到目标Oracle实例。Oracle客户端提供了连接到远程Oracle数据库的必要组件和驱动程序。
  3. 配置TNSnames文件:在Oracle客户端的安装目录中,找到并编辑TNSnames.ora文件。在该文件中添加一个新的连接描述符,包括目标Oracle实例的主机名、端口号和服务名。
  4. 测试连接:使用Oracle客户端提供的工具(如SQL*Plus或SQL Developer)测试连接是否成功。使用新添加的连接描述符进行连接,并验证是否能够成功登录到目标Oracle实例。

连接到Oracle实例的优势:

  • 数据安全性:Oracle提供了强大的安全功能,包括身份验证、访问控制和数据加密,确保数据的安全性。
  • 高可用性:Oracle实例可以配置为高可用性集群,确保在一个实例故障时仍然可以提供服务。
  • 数据一致性:Oracle实例支持ACID事务,保证数据的一致性和完整性。
  • 扩展性:Oracle实例可以根据需求进行水平或垂直扩展,以满足不断增长的数据量和用户访问量。

应用场景:

  • 企业级应用程序:Oracle数据库广泛应用于企业级应用程序,如ERP、CRM和人力资源管理系统等。
  • 数据仓库和商业智能:Oracle提供了强大的数据仓库和商业智能功能,用于数据分析和决策支持。
  • 云原生应用:Oracle提供了云原生数据库服务,可用于构建和部署云原生应用程序。

腾讯云相关产品:

  • 云数据库 TencentDB for Oracle:腾讯云提供的托管式Oracle数据库服务,提供高可用性、弹性扩展和自动备份等功能。详情请参考:https://cloud.tencent.com/product/tcdb-oracle

请注意,以上答案仅供参考,具体的配置和产品选择应根据实际需求和情况进行决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

为同机器多个Oracle实例配置独立监听器

为保证网络隔离,并且支持并为不同实例设置不同wallet/sqlnet/tnsnames/listener/TDE/SSL/EUS认证等配置,这里提供一个办法为每个实例配置单独监听器,每个监听器设置不同环境变量配置文件...,并且讨论配置带来操作规范要求和可能影响; 监听器启动分析 一般来说,在单机实例,可以通过修改$ORACLE_HOME/network/admin/listener.ora和lsnrctl命令创建监听...在RAC环境,为实例添加独立监听器操作也是比较简单: DB用户:oracle 监听端口:1524 DB:test122 监听器名称:test122 su - oracle srvctl add...,会ocr中读取并配置环境变量再启动服务; 最后, 一旦进程环境变量设置,启动后再也没办法修改,如果修改需要重启进程(database/listener) 综合以上几种不同场景,解决办法: 为每个实例在...进程,所以需要在机器对单个实例节点进行listener/database启动/重启操作时候,操作之前需要先加载对应实例环境变量。

2.3K40

Oracle:Enterprise Manager 无法连接到数据库实例。下面列出了组件状态。 以及 Oracle11g OracleDBConsoleorcl服务无法启动问题

问题描述:    我们 主机 通过 浏览器 访问装在 虚拟机上 Oracle企业管理器 时,出现如下图问题: ?   ...OracleDBConsole[SID]服务简介    OracleDBConsole[SID]服务负责Windows平台下启动Oracle企业管理器,Oracle 10g开始引入这个服务,也是Oracle...10g开始;   Oracle企业管理器客户端形式变为浏览器操作模式,这里[SID]即Oracle SID,如果是默认安装就是orcl,故这个服务在你机器可能就是OracleDBConsoleORCL...,事实在我机器也是它。   ...首先删除资料档案库,注意:此时Oracle监听器服务和数据库服务必须处于启动状态,因为删除命令会连接到数据库删除SYSMAN用户及其所属对象:     Microsoft Windows XP [版本

3K10

Oracle 11g DG Broker配置服务高可用

TAF特性: 1:TAF是ORACLE客户端提供一项特性,使用TAF,对客户端环境有一定要求,比如JavaJDBC驱动、Oracle客户端版本等(8i开始支持TAF); 2:大致TAF可以分为...,即使数据库实例重启,也不需要重新连接; 4:TAF配置可以在客户端也可以在服务器端,也就是在连接数据库时候,比如程序url添加, 或者tnsname.ora中配置FAILOVER_MODE=(TYPE...参数后将会禁用TAF; 6:oracle TAF特性和scan ip failover区别是,scan ip连接的话如果scan ip所在节点故障, 那么该连接就断开了,如果程序中没有自动重机制,...或者程序连接池中timeout值还没有 到时间,那么你就必须重启服务以便于重数据库,但是TAF的话不会让程序报错,只是会回滚 没有提交事务,自动重另一个节点,并且FAILOVER_TYPE=>'...特性,所以你服务并不会报错(ORA-0133:ORACLE initialization or shutdown in progress错误),而是自动接到主库!

1.1K10

深入了解 Oracle Flex ASM 及其优点

零、前 言 Oracle Flex ASM 允许 Oracle ASM 实例运行在与数据库服务器分离物理服务器。...本质是一个中心和叶架构,Oracle Clusterware 通过一个替代 ASM 实例将故障节点连接将无缝转移到另一个成员节点。...Oracle 12c Oracle 12c 之前混合版本(不同版本) 和平常一样,ASM 实例将在每个节点运行,Flex 配置支持 12c 之前数据库。...这种方法优点是,如果 Oracle 12c 数据库实例与一个 ASM 实例连接断开,数据库连接将故障切换至其他服务器另一个 ASM 实例。... RAC 数据库实例 1 (rac1) 连接到 RAC 数据库实例 2 (rac2) ASM 实例 [oracle@oel6-112-rac1 Desktop]$ . oraenv ORACLE_SID

83670

Oracle RAC failover 测试(TAF方式)

#简单一点来说,就是说对于那些已经成功连接到特定实例客户端,如果该实例或节点异常宕机,客户端会自动重新发出到剩余实例 #接请求。...#通过在客户端tnsnames.ora中配置FAILOVER_MODE项实现TAF 2、服务器端、客户端环境 #服务器端环境,host信息 oracle@bo2dbp:~> cat /etc...此时,假定select查询已返回500行,客户端当前连接节点出现故障,Oracle Net自动建立连接到幸存实例并继续返回 剩余行数给客户端。...RETRIES: 表示重试次数 DELAY:表示重试间隔时间 4、测试TAF #首次建立连接,此时客户端tnsnames配置第一个IP建立连接,由于第一个VIP所在实例已经关闭...select方式多用在OLAP类型数据库,而session多用在OLTP类型数据库 e、一旦所在实例发生故障,会自动failover,无需手动重新连接,这就是与连接时故障转移所不同

1.6K40

Oracle 11g R2 RAC 高可用连接特性 – SCAN 详解

PRIVATE IP : 称为私网 IP(私有 IP),它是用于心跳同步,也就是保证两台服务器数据同步。说到私网 IP,我简单说下 Oracle 另一个高可用性连接特性 – HAIP。...两个参数 LOCAL_LISTENER : 这是 Oracle 参数,这个参数控制着本地监听器注册,因为本地监听器工作机制关系,通过本地监听器数据库连接请求只会连接到本地节点实例。...,也就是连接到其本地节点实例。...R2 客户端配合使不同客户端能够连接到不同 SCAN Listener ,这相当于是 Oracle 10g 中配置客户端负载均衡(通过 LOAD_BALANCE=yes 配置)。...使用 SCAN 连接数据库实例,整个过程实现了客户端 Failover(Oracle 10g R2 是通过 FAILOVER=on 来配置),DNS 服务器返回是一个 SCAN VIP 列表,客户端会选择其中一个连接到

2.4K50

YH4:Oracle Flex Clusters

Hub节点和Leaf节点可以承载不同类型应用程序。...使用Hub节点来托管读写数据库实例。 Leaf节点与标准Oracle Grid Infrastructure节点不同,因为它们不需要直接访问共享存储,而是通过Hub节点请求数据。...在Hub节点计划关闭期间,leaf node会尝试连接到另一个ub node,除非leaf node仅连接到一个hub node。...在Reader node中,12.2开始,允许创建本地临时表空间,当用户连接到reader node实例时候,就可以使用;而当用户连接到read-write实例时候,则使用共享临时表空间...Recovery Buddy Oracle ADG列式存储支持 Oracle ADG列式存储支持Oracle ADG列式存储支持 通过在相邻实例配置recovery buddy,可以实现实例快速配置

1K50

YH12:一篇文章读懂SCAN

使用单一名称访问集群以连接到此集群中数据库,客户端可以使用EZConnect和简单JDBC瘦URL来访问集群中运行任何数据库,而与集群中运行数据库或服务器数量无关,集群中所请求数据库实际是处于活动状态服务器...结果应该是,每次“nslookup”将以不同顺序返回一组三个IP。 ? 注意:如果DNS服务器没有返回一组三个IP,如上图所示或不循环,请咨询网络管理员启用此类设置。...因此,建议使用SCAN连接到数据库客户端最小版本是Oracle Database 11.2或更高版本。 使用客户端DNS缓存可能会产生DNS覆盖不会DNS服务器发生错误印象。...现在已经创建了另一个SCAN设置,使用不同子网进行公共通信,并创建了相应节点VIP,节点侦听器和SCAN侦听器,将需要使用这些SCAN通知数据库如何注册。...然后,它会将连接请求重新定向到运行最少加载实例节点本地侦听器。 随后,客户端将被给予本地侦听器地址。 本地侦听器将最终创建与数据库实例连接。 ? 本文来自Oracle官方白皮书翻译。 ?

1.9K60

Oracle 12.2新特性掌上手册 - 第五卷 RAC and Grid

6 Switch Service Enhancement(切换服务增强) 此功能将物理连接与逻辑服务分离,以使连接上服务能够在请求边界切换到在该数据库和实例处发布服务另一个连接。...只要现有主实例出现故障或群集管理员将其删除,辅助实例就可以升级到主角色。此外,共享GNS高可用性通过使用区域传输机制在辅助实例采取数据备份来提供容错。辅助实例在安装期间实例接收数据副本。...和内存,确定应用程序是否可以作为启动一部分或作为故障转移结果在给定服务器启动度量。...Oracle Flex Cluster架构中OLTP和读取操作分离允许快速重新配置加入和离开群集只读实例,以及对这些实例缓冲区缓存有效更新。...当在集群中运行Oracle RAC数据库实例上访问数据时,数据相关缓存会使得不同节点响应时间一致。

1.6K41

YH3:一文全面了解Oracle RAC One Node

在线数据库重定位是一种Oracle RAC One Node特有功能,可将Oracle RAC One Node数据库实例重新定位到群集中另一个服务器,而不会中断数据库服务。...考虑到这些假设,使用在线数据库重定位在线维护可以通过四个简单步骤执行(根据场景,可以进一步优化三个步骤): 启动源到目标的在线数据库重定位 在源服务器修补Oracle数据库主页 回滚(重新定位到源服务器...由于源数据库实例现在已停止,并且假设没有其他数据库相应数据库主服务器运行,因此,源服务器数据库主目录现在可以进行修补(请参阅步骤3),隐式使用本机固有的滚动升级功能Oracle RAC数据库。...使用动态数据库服务来管理和管理PDB,这些应用程序也将被应用程序用于连接到相应PDB,就像使用Oracle Net Services进行连接实例Oracle数据库一样。...虚拟化已成为服务器虚拟化代名词,但存在许多不同类型虚拟化。 服务器虚拟化是最简单虚拟化形式,可以提供许多上述优点,具有不同程度实用性。 ?

1.8K50

Oracle 12.2新特性掌上手册 - 第七卷 Big Data and Data Warehousing

该架构允许分配专用于并行执行查询大量处理引擎。 ? 作用 Oracle并行处理服务器场允许用户在大型集群系统上部署可扩展处理架构,专门用于并行查询操作。...读/写实例是常规Oracle数据库实例,可以处理对数据更新(例如,DML语句UPDATE,DELETE,INSERT和MERGE),分区维护操作等。可以直接连接到读/写实例。...只读实例只能处理查询,不能直接更新数据。不能直接连接到只读实例。请注意,存在包含更新和查询数据并行SQL语句(例如,INSERT INTO )。...在这种情况下,语句部分在读/写和只读实例处理,而INSERT部分仅在读/写实例处理。...作用 只读实例引入显着提高了数据仓库工作负载并行查询可扩展性,并允许Oracle数据库在数百个物理节点运行。

1.7K81

配置共享服务器模式

TCP或TCPS等直接建立连接,且此类服务器进程不为实例所有 该类服务器进程一旦建立,直到退出和关闭该会话相关资源才被释放 建立服务器进程过程(参照Expert Oracle Database...则使用SGAlarge pool 来处理所有队列 共享服务器模式强制使用Oracle Net,而不论客户端与服务器是否处于同一台主机 当使用共享模式连接时,服务器所有本地连接(包括sysdba...建立连接)都会得到一个专用服务器,使用IPC进行连接 在专用模式下,同一台主机本地连接同样使用Oracle Net,且使用网络协议为IPC 当客户端连接到服务器时候,不能显示看到有新进程产生...连接到Dispatcher后,Dispatcher将随机分配服务器一个端口号, Listener将该端口号返回给客户端,接下来客户端将断开与Listener连接而直接与dispatcher建立连接...客户端使用下列不同方式连接到客户端 SQL> conn sys/redhat@list2 as sysdba --任意连接方式 Connected.

2.2K30

Oracle数据库关键系统服务整理

另外,还列出了基本所有的Oracle服务极其作用,这部分可以当作索引使用。...但我一般情况下可能经常只对某一个数据库进行操作,此时就可以通过控制面板将其他数据库实例服务关掉,避免占用系统资源。一个数据库实例关闭不影响另一个数据库实例使用。...如果只开启OracleService服务,那么我们只能:应用连接到数据库中,使用Oracle自带isqlplus连接到数据库。...2、OracleTNSListener服务(非必须启动) 这个服务用于启动ORACLE实例服务,实现客户端和服务器通信,当需要用远程管理工具如plsql等远程访问数据库时才需要开启此服务...根据不同版本Oracle,这个监听名字略有不同,我是:OracleOraDb10g_home1TNSListener。

70130

Oracle执行shutdown immediate后登陆不上解决方法

启动数据库实例方法有很多种,分别介绍如下: 1、使用SQLPLUS 使用SQLPLUS连接到具有管理员权限Oracle如使用,然后发布startup命令,从而启动数据库。...启动数据库实例步骤:以没有连接数据库方法启动SQL*PLUS:sqlplus /nolog,然后作为SYSDBA连接到oracle:connect username/password as sysdba...接着使用startup命令来启动数据库实例oracle必须服务器参数文件或者传统文本初始化参数文件中读取实例配置文件。...当使用不带pfile子句startup命令时,oracle将从平台指定默认位置服务器参数文件(spfile)中读取初始化参数。...启动数据库实例可以采用不同模式: 1、启动但没有装载数据库实例,这种模式不允许访问数据库,并且通常只适用于数据库创建或者控制文件重新创建情况。

77620

Oracle架构、原理、进程

先来看一个图,这个图取自于教材,这个图对于整体理解ORACLE 体系结构组件,非常关键。 首先看张图: ?...我们来引入第一个概念,Oracle服务器,所谓Oracle服务器是一个数据库管理系统,它包括一个Oracle实例(动态)和一个Oracle数据库(静态)。...最后,举一个用户提交SQL语句例子来结束本文,如果用户想提交SQL语句,那么首先你必须要连接到Oracle实例,连接到Oracle实例有三种途径:如果用户登陆到运行Oracle实例操作系统,则通过进程间通信进行访问...发起连接应用程序或工具通常称为用户进程,连接发起后,Oracle服务器就会创建一个进程来接受连接,这个进程就成为服务进程,服务器进程代表用户进程与Oracle实例进行通信,在专用服务器连接模式下,用户进程和服务进程是...启动一个实例时,Oracle参数文件中读取控制文件名字和位置。安装数据库时,Oracle打开控制文件。最终打开数据库时,Oracle控制文件中读取数据文件列表并打开其中每个文件。

2.9K21

干货分享 | 史上最全Oracle体系结构整理

这是一种负载均衡概念(使一起运行设备负担负载达到一个近似相同状态), 可提高数据库性能和并发性。理论讲,数据库性能提高了两倍。...比如我们访问淘宝网站,我们通过ie浏览器连接到淘宝web服务器,也就是它应用服务器。然后我们要买鞋子,比如要买什么厂商鞋子,我们在网上选中搜索条件以后点击搜索。...用户连接到应用服务器以后,它会进行一些操作,它要搜鞋子,鞋子信息在数据库里面。...oracle数据库会接到这个SQL语句,然后对SQL语句解析执行,获取到数据,通过连接再传给应用服务器。应用服务器接到以后,然后再传给我们消费者。 这就是整个一个过程。...也就是说,我们oracle数据库,实际在大量接受SQL,在解析SQL,然后执行SQL,然后获取数据。把数据再返给应用服务器。这就是宏观上去看,oracle日常工作状态。

65520

配置ORACLE 客户端连接到数据库

客户端连接到Oracle 数据库服务器貌似不同于SQL serve中网络配置,其实不然,只不过所有的SQL server 运行于Windows平台,故很多配置直接集成到了操作系统之中。...所以无需配置客户端即可连接到服务器Oracle 客户端连接到数据库依赖于Oracle Net。Oracle提供了很多基于客户端或服务器配置工具,需要搞清Oracle Net 中相关术语。...服务名(service_name) 客户端连接到实例服务名,可以为该参数指定一个或多个服务名。该参数9i引入,service_name通常可以使用SID代替。...实例将所定义服务名注册到侦听器,当客户端请求服务时,侦听器根据服务名决定将使用哪个实例提供所请求服务并与之建立连接 基于相同数据库可以定义多不不同服务名来区分不同使用情况 如定义service_name...:用户名、密码、IP地址、端口号、服务名 2.客户端成功连接到数据库服务器 客户端要求 需要安装适当客户端软件(Oracle Client) 正确配置sqlnet.ora NAMES.DIRECTORY_PATH

5.5K30

Oracle GoldenGate微服务架构

可以出于以下目的配置Oracle GoldenGate: 从一个数据库中静态提取数据记录,并将这些记录加载到另一个数据库中。...只有在以下情况中提到MA版本不适用于该平台时,才可以将Oracle GoldenGate安装和配置为使用Oracle GoldenGate Classic体系结构:从一个数据库中静态提取数据记录,并将这些记录加载到另一个数据库中...简化对Oracle GoldenGate环境多种实现管理,并控制用户对Oracle GoldenGate设置和监视不同方面的访问。...它与分发服务器互操作,并与用于远程经典部署经典体系结构泵兼容。 Receiver Server用单个实例服务替换多个离散目标端收集器。...在支持MA设计某些方面,使用Admin Client相似的方式有所不同: GGSCI Admin Client 连接到本地流程 连接到任何MA部署 需要本地计算机访问权限,通常是SSH 需要HTTP或

1.7K20
领券